Joann Fletcher (born 30 August 1966) is an Egyptologist and Honorary Visiting Professor in the Department of Archaeology at the University of York. She specializes in the history of mummification and has studied mummies on site in Egypt, Yemen and South America as well as in museum collections around the world. Hawass matched a tooth found in a box associated with Hatshepsut to the jaw socket of a mummy found in Luxors Valley of the Kings, the ancient royal necropolis. The National Geographic Society named him explorer-in-residence in 2001, an honor he shared with primatologist Jane Goodall, filmmaker James Cameron and paleontologists Meave and Louise Leakey. Last spring the prosecutor general banned him from traveling outside Egypt, pending investigation of dozens of charges of impropriety and corruption brought against him by a pair of former colleagues. To illustrate the affect, one of the most spectacular episodes of this time was the inundation of the vast Dogger Bank, which lies between Britain and Denmark. A traveling exhibition he put together of five dozen artifacts from the Egyptian Museum, Tutankhamun and the Golden Age of the Pharaohs, earned $110 million for Egypt during its tour of seven cities in Europe and the United States. .
